Privacy and Data Security Measures

Protecting student data is a fundamental aspect of online peer review platforms. These platforms implement robust privacy measures to ensure that sensitive information remains confidential and secure from unauthorized access. Encryption protocols are typically used to safeguard data during transmission and storage, minimizing the risk of breaches.

Most platforms also adhere to strict data security standards, such as GDPR or FERPA compliance, to meet legal requirements and protect user privacy. These regulations mandate transparent data management practices, including consent procedures and data retention policies, which are crucial in educational settings.

Additionally, secure authentication methods, like multi-factor authentication and user access controls, restrict platform access to authorized individuals only. Regular security audits and updates further enhance protection, addressing emerging threats and vulnerabilities. Ensuring privacy and data security remains a top priority in choosing online peer review platforms for classroom integration.

Best Practices for Implementing Peer Review Platforms in Courses

Implementing peer review platforms effectively requires clear instructional guidance and well-defined expectations to ensure meaningful engagement. Instructors should provide students with rubrics or criteria to facilitate focused and constructive feedback, promoting consistency across evaluations.

Facilitating training sessions or tutorials on using online peer review platforms can enhance student confidence and usability. It is important to emphasize the value of respectful communication and original analysis, fostering a positive review environment.

Monitoring and moderating peer reviews help maintain quality and address potential issues such as bias or superficial feedback. Regular check-ins enable instructors to adjust strategies and reinforce best practices.

Finally, integrating peer review activities into the overall course assessment clarifies their importance, motivating students to participate diligently. Adopting these best practices ensures the effective and meaningful use of online peer review platforms in educational settings.
